Fern Lea

Fern Lea is in Sleights. It’s a big, semi-detached Edwardian house. Sleeps ten, five bedrooms, three bathrooms. It’s got a 4 Star rating. The place is spacious and the views over the valley are good.

It’s about four miles from the middle of Whitby. The village shop is five hundred yards away. There’s a pub and a restaurant about three hundred yards from the house. Both are fine.

The stairs are a typical house staircase, not too steep. The garden is enclosed. There’s parking for a couple of cars. You can bring up to two dogs.

Facilities are listed, but the main ones are: WiFi, TV, dishwasher, washing machine, cot and highchair if you need them. Bedding and towels are included. There’s a barbecue.

For walking, you can get straight onto the bridleways from the door. Whitby has the harbour, the abbey ruins, and a long sandy beach. Ruswarp village is walkable and has a miniature railway and boat hire on the river.

About six miles away is Goathland, the Heartbeat village. You can get the steam train from there across the moors to Pickering. It’s a good day out.

Scarborough is further south, maybe a forty minute drive. York is about an hour’s drive if you want a city day.
